Skip to content

Instantly share code, notes, and snippets.

@thaisviana
Created August 21, 2020 20:29
Show Gist options
  • Save thaisviana/2224e4ac16b4d36421993f7340703327 to your computer and use it in GitHub Desktop.
Save thaisviana/2224e4ac16b4d36421993f7340703327 to your computer and use it in GitHub Desktop.
Filme.vue
<template>
<div class="row">
<div class="col-12 mt-5">
<h3>Esse é o produto com o id {{ $route.params.id }}</h3>
<p>{{ filmeAtual }}</p>
</div>
</div>
</template>
<script>
export default {
name: "Filme",
data() {
return {
filmeAtual : {},
filmes: [
{
id: "4",
titulo: "Star Wars IV",
subtitulo: "Uma Nova Esperança",
valor: 30,
avaliacao : 3,
estoqueDisponivel: 7,
imagem:
"https://upload.wikimedia.org/wikipedia/commons/6/6c/Star_Wars_Logo.svg",
descricao:
"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.",
},
{
id: "1",
titulo: "Star Wars I",
subtitulo: "A Ameaça Fantasma",
valor: 10,
avaliacao : 4,
estoqueDisponivel: 1,
imagem:
"https://upload.wikimedia.org/wikipedia/commons/6/6c/Star_Wars_Logo.svg",
descricao:
"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.",
},
{
id: "2",
titulo: "Star Wars II",
subtitulo: "Ataque dos Clones",
valor: 20,
avaliacao : 5,
estoqueDisponivel: 0,
imagem:
"https://upload.wikimedia.org/wikipedia/commons/6/6c/Star_Wars_Logo.svg",
descricao:
"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.",
},
{
id: "3",
titulo: "Star Wars III",
subtitulo: "A Vingança dos Sith",
valor: 30,
avaliacao : 5,
estoqueDisponivel: 3,
imagem:
"https://upload.wikimedia.org/wikipedia/commons/6/6c/Star_Wars_Logo.svg",
descricao:
"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.",
},
{
id: "5",
titulo: "Star Wars V",
subtitulo: "O Império Contra-Ataca",
valor: 20,
avaliacao : 4,
estoqueDisponivel: 2,
imagem:
"https://upload.wikimedia.org/wikipedia/commons/6/6c/Star_Wars_Logo.svg",
descricao:
"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.",
},
{
id: "6",
titulo: "Star Wars VI",
subtitulo: "O Império Contra-Ataca",
valor: 30,
avaliacao : 4,
estoqueDisponivel: 2,
imagem:
"https://upload.wikimedia.org/wikipedia/commons/6/6c/Star_Wars_Logo.svg",
descricao:
"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.",
},
{
id: "7",
titulo: "Star Wars VII",
subtitulo: "O Despertar da Força",
valor: 30,
avaliacao : 4,
estoqueDisponivel: 7,
imagem:
"https://upload.wikimedia.org/wikipedia/commons/6/6c/Star_Wars_Logo.svg",
descricao:
"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.",
},
{
id: "8",
titulo: "Star Wars VIII",
subtitulo: "Os Últimos Jedi",
valor: 20,
avaliacao : 4,
estoqueDisponivel: 2,
imagem:
"https://upload.wikimedia.org/wikipedia/commons/6/6c/Star_Wars_Logo.svg",
descricao:
"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.",
},
{
id: "9",
titulo: "Star Wars IX",
subtitulo: "A Ascensão Skywalker",
valor: 30,
avaliacao : 4,
estoqueDisponivel: 2,
imagem:
"https://upload.wikimedia.org/wikipedia/commons/6/6c/Star_Wars_Logo.svg",
descricao:
"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.",
},
],
}
},
created() {
let id = this.$route.params.id
this.filmeAtual = this.filmes.filter(filme => filme.id == id)[0]
console.log(id)
console.log(this.filmes.filter(filme => filme.id == id))
}
};
</script>
<style scoped>
</style>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ment